About Min Yu

Min Yu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ology, Endocrine and Autonomic Systems, Immunology and Pharmacology, having authored 63 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Obstructive Sleep Apnea Research (10 papers),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(4 papers), Sleep and Wakefulness Research (3 papers),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(3 papers), dental development and anomalies (3 papers), Orthodontics and Dentofacial Orthopedics (2 papers), Glycosylation and Glycoproteins Research (2 papers) and Gut microbiota and health (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Infectious Diseases (249 citations), Endocrine and Autonomic Systems (55 citations), Neurology (105 citations), Complementary and Manual Therapy (14 citations) and Physiology (160 citations). Min Yu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Slovakia. Frequent co-authors include Xuemei Gao, Honggang Yu, Zuojiong Gong, Jie Wei, Yao Xu, Xuemei Jia, Weiguo Dong, G. Wang, Ke Hu and J. Li.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Oral Rehabilitation, PLoS ONE, BMC Oral Health, Frontiers in Immunology and The Journal of Immunology.
